What is Condensation?
Condensation happens when water vapor in the air cools and becomes liquid water. Repair Double Glazing Units is influenced by temperature and humidity levels in the environment. When warm air, which can hold more moisture, enters contact with a cooler surface area (like a window glass), it cools down. If the air's temperature level drops below its dew point, the moisture condenses on the glass, forming beads of water.

Causes of Condensation in Windows
A number of elements contribute to condensation forming on windows. The main causes consist of:
High Indoor Humidity: Cooking, showering, drying clothing, and even breathing add to indoor humidity levels. Extreme moisture in little, poorly aerated areas is a prime condition for condensation.
Temperature level Difference: When warm air inside a room meets the cold surface area of a window, condensation can occur. This is especially apparent throughout winter season months when indoor temperature levels may be substantially warmer than outdoor temperatures.
Air Tightness: Modern homes are often constructed with a concentrate on energy performance, resulting in tight building. While this avoids heat loss, it likewise restricts airflow and can cause moisture to develop inside.
Insulating Properties of Windows: Older single-pane windows are especially prone to condensation since they lack the insulating properties of modern-day double or triple-glazed windows. This can make them cold sufficient to promote condensation during cooler months.

Effects of Window Condensation
While condensation is a natural process, it can have destructive effects if not managed appropriately. A few of these effects consist of:
- Mold Growth: Persistent moisture can lead to mold, which can negatively affect health and demand expensive remediation.
- Damage to Window Frames: Wood window frames can warp or rot due to prolonged direct exposure to moisture.
- Peeling Paint and Wallpaper: Excess moisture can damage paint and wallpaper, resulting in peeling and destruction.
- Lowered Visibility: Condensation can impair presence through windows, detracting from the aesthetic appeals of a space.
Handling and Preventing Window Condensation
Handling condensation needs a multi-faceted technique. Here are a number of strategies to decrease its occurrence:
1. Control Indoor Humidity
- Use Exhaust Fans: Installing exhaust fans in bathroom and kitchens can help eliminate excess moisture.
- Dehumidifiers: Using a dehumidifier can considerably reduce humidity levels, especially in areas susceptible to dampness.
- Houseplants: Limit the number of houseplants, as they release moisture into the air.
2. Improve Air Circulation
- Open Windows: Occasionally opening windows can help promote much better air circulation and decrease moisture accumulation.
- Usage Ceiling Fans: Ceiling fans can assist circulate air and maintain constant temperature level throughout a room.
3. Upgrade Windows
- Set Up Double or Triple-Glazed Windows: These kinds of windows offer better insulation, lessening the temperature difference in between the outdoors and inside surfaces.
- Apply Window Treatments: Insulating window film or thermal curtains can assist maintain indoor temperature level.
4. Insulation
- Insulate Walls and Attics: Proper insulation of walls and attics can help preserve a more steady indoor temperature, minimizing the occurrence of condensation.
